Work Experience

BioGenetics Corp. - Boston, MA

Senior Statistician June 2021 to Present 5 years & 1 month

Led statistical design and analysis for 10+ clinical trials (Phase I-III), contributing to successful FDA submissions.
Developed and validated predictive models for patient response to novel therapies, improving treatment efficacy by 15%.
Mentored junior statisticians on best practices in experimental design, statistical software (R, SAS), and data interpretation.
Collaborated with cross-functional teams (clinical, regulatory, R&D) to define study objectives and ensure statistical rigor.

PharmaSolutions Inc. - Cambridge, MA

Statistician July 2017 to June 2021 4 years

Conducted statistical analysis for preclinical and early-phase clinical studies, supporting drug discovery and development.
Designed and implemented A/B tests for optimizing drug delivery methods, resulting in a 10% improvement in bioavailability.
Automated data cleaning and reporting processes using Python, reducing analysis time by 20 hours per study.
Presented complex statistical findings to non-technical stakeholders, facilitating data-driven decision-making.
